Chapter 363 – God of the Sky (7)
[Let’s go to my temple . ]
Said the God of Hope .
Out of the blue .
“Why your temple?”
[Don’t you need time anyways?]
“What time . ”
The God of Hope made a giggling sound .
I had heard it many times already, but each time I heard it it was a fresh, irritable laugh .
[If you are crushed because you need time to clear up your confused mind, is there a need to shiver on a cold roof like this? If you need guidance and rest, let’s go to my temple . ]
Even the roof is not bad because I can think quietly by myself .
And I haven’t even caught the lower god who has fled here yet .
I have no intention of leaving this planet before then .
[It’s not far from here . ]
“Huh? Here?”
[If you turn to the left in the direction you are looking at, it will be quick . ]
Looking at the direction the God of Hope said, I saw the roof of a temple building .
The temple was easy to recognize .
Because there needs to be symbolism .
Temples are always designed with the feeling of ‘oh, this building is a temple” .
“That’s your temple?”
[Yes . ]
It was surprising .
Truly .
I couldn’t easily accept the fact that there was a temple of the God of Hope in the middle of the city .
No, its existence on the planet itself was strange .
The reason was obvious .
It was because of the grotesque ideals of the God of Hope .
The God of Hope believes that the most desperate moment is the moment when hope shines the most .
And there was no urgency on this planet .
They couldn’t get desperate .
It is a planet where many gods are competing for benefits .
In the midst of this, if a person’s life is to become desperate, they would need a very elaborate and complex story .
Even if the God of Hope encouraged such a situation to his believers, it would not be easy to maintain it .
It was only if the believers abandoned the God of Hope and returned to other gods .
So I did not expect that there would be a temple of the God of Hope on this planet .
However, the God of Hope introduced the temple in the middle of the city as his own temple .
Oh, that’s it .
Something like the hidden dark forces of the continent .
A social group that is intriguingly conspiring to destroy the peace in the world .
As I recalled, it was plausible .
[That is a false preconceived notion . ]
What false preconceived notion .
I think it fits within the probability of his behaviors .
[If you go, you will know . ]
“If I go, I feel like I’m going to feel uncomfortable . ”
He must have hidden something like a torture chamber in the basement of the temple .
It was clear .
First, I headed to the temple as the God of Hope said .

I needed time to organize my thoughts .
There was also a need for planning to catch the lower god .
Most of all, I wanted to see the temple of the God of Hope, which stimulated my curiosity .
*
“What, this is…… . ”
The temple of the God of Hope was unexpectedly bright and lively .
The believers wandering around looked relaxed and clear, as if they came out of a neighborhood drinking party rather than a temple .
Priestesses were serving people with smiles like salespeople .
People looked peaceful .
I got little goosebumps .
[What was that you were saying earlier?]
The God of Hope said in an elated voice as if he had won .
“What…… . ”
Is it such a level of mental pollution that I can’t even notice?
Otherwise, it couldn’t be explained .
[Don’t keep saying nonsense . ]
As I was blankly looking at the people around me, a priestess came to me .
The priestess was wearing a robe uniform with a sprout drawn on it .
Is that sprout a symbol of the Church of Hope?
It’s ridiculous .
[That is the case here . ]
Oh my gosh .
It’s the end, it’s the end .
That kind of society is using a hopeful symbol like a sprout .
It was a Church of Hope without even a minimum of conscience .
[Would you stop being so sarcastic?]
“Brother, is this your first time here?”
The God of Hope and the priestess asked at the same time .
I nodded .
*
The priestess guided me to a private parlor .
As soon as I entered the parlor where I was guided, I patted various places on the wall .
There seems to be no hidden room .
“Why are you knocking on the wall?”
“I was wondering if there was a trap installed . ”
Like sleeping gas .
Like paralyzing poison .
Or just poisons .
Like curse magic .
Or just an arrow .
“No such thing, brother . ”
The priestess said with a smile .
As she said, there was no such thing as a trap .
That’s why .
I wonder if there is a trap that even tricks my senses .
That was more rational .
Rather than accepting the fact that the temple of the God of Hope is really a normal temple, it’s better to think that there’s some terrible trap hiding .
“You can write simple personal information here . ”
The priestess handed out a piece of paper .
Oh, is this a trap too?
Are you trying to take advantage of other people’s personal information?
[This is a guestbook . Just roughly write something down . ]
It wasn’t .
As I drew graffiti in the guestbook, the priestess asked me about my visit .
[You can say you need guidance . ]
As he said, I stated I needed guidance .
Then the priestess was greatly pleased .
“If you have any thoughts of returning-”
“Nope . ”
I said in a nutshell .
“Yes?”
“No . ”
“Ah… Yes . ”
The priestess was visibly disappointed .
But she didn’t do missionary work any more than that .
Instead, she asked again about the business .
“Then what kind of guidance would you like?”
I said that I would like to ask the priestess to guide me to the temple of the lower god I saw earlier .
Advertisement
“Ah, it was a guide! Please wait here for a moment . I’ll be ready soon . ”
The priestess said so and left her parlor .
I don’t know what she’s going to prepare .
[Simple . She’s just changing into outdoor clothes and coming . ]
Is that so?
Well .
[What, if there is anything you want to ask, ask . ]
Said the God of Hope .
As he said, there was something I wanted to ask .
“Why is that priestess trying to guide my way? We are not from the same church . ”
[That is the role of my priests . To guide . ]
It doesn’t suit you .
[Hope is a vague expectation . ]
The God of Hope explained .
[The role of my priests is to be a light that illuminates when people are lost and wandering, or when they are unable to go on their own . As a result, people give hope to me, and in addition, even if there is a problem in the future, they can ask for help from the nearby Temple of Hope . ]
It was a very different story from the view of hope of the God of Hope that I had known before .
The God of Hope is not satisfied with the meaning of a light that marks milestones on the road or a degree of prevention that can overcome anxiety about the future .
[So my priests show people the way . They guide you through the streets and provide directions to people who are mentally wandering . The answer is not always correct, but it is my priests who will walk together . ]
I couldn’t take it anymore and asked .
That isn’t like his ideal .
Does he not believe that hope in despair is the brightest hope?
[Of course it is . ]
The God of Hope replied .
[But is there any reason to ask for only the strongest hope? Weak hope is also hope . Of course, from my point of view, it would be nice to receive strong hope with faith, but if the situation doesn’t work, I have to pursue other methods .
Is it different depending on the situation?
When I think about it, it was .
If you think of the sanctuaries of the God of Hope who were in an extreme situation like hell .
They were all sacred sites of the God of Hope or areas exclusively owned by the God of Hope .
It was the same on the 49th floor of the Tutorial when I first encountered the God of Hope .
It was a world of mixed religions .
All denominations fell and only the sanctuary of the God of Hope remained .
The reason the God of Hope established a truly hopeful denomination on this planet was not for good or evil and not for morality .
It was just a management strategy according to the conditions .
When I thought so, I finally understood .

Following the priestess, I went back to the streets .
There was one obvious advantage .
Since there was a priestess attached to me as a guide, there were no people who bothered me for missionary work .
There was also one drawback .
Seregia was eating too much from the priestess .
It’s a bit embarrassing as a party .
“He said that if we believed in the God of the Earth, he would give grilled skewers for free . ”
“I’ll buy it instead!”
Like an idiot, the priestess kept buying food for Seregia .
It was already the fourth time I saw it .
Perhaps the priestess seemed to be still open to the possibility of us returning to the Temple of Hope .
Unfortunately, she was unable to give up her vain hope .
[All my priestesses are underpaid . Stop . ]
The God of Hope said this .
After taking Seregia who was trying to eat all the street foods, I headed to a place where I felt the energy of the lower god .
A long, long staircase stretched from the street to the building on the hillside .
It wasn’t a very high mountain by my standards, but it seemed too difficult for an average person to walk up .
The stairs were steep and too high .
No matter how much I looked at it, it wasn’t a stairway to be climbed .
“Let’s go . ”
The priestess spoke briskly and began to climb the stairs in the lead .
As she climbed the stairs she asked me .
“Seeing you go to the sage, do you have any concerns?”
“Sage?”
“Yes, the sage over there . ”
The priestess said, pointing to the shrine on the hillside .
Sage .
Was the lower god serving as a sage here?
It was surprising .
I asked about the sage .
As the priestess headed to the sage, I questioned her about the sage, but she answered me sincerely .
“He is a wise person . If there is a major disaster or crisis on the continent, he’ll tell us . He thinks deeply about even the smallest issues between people and makes wise judgments . ”
Listening to the priestess’ words, the sage did not seem to be regarded as a god .
Could he maintain faith through mere respect?
It seemed to be possible if he was not a definite god but a lower god of an ambiguous level .
Pretending to be a sage may be his strategy in order to receive faith on this planet where several gods coexist .
“Then there must be many people visiting . ”
“Well, as you can see . ”
The priestess said .
There were not a few people climbing the stairs .
“But there aren’t many people who meet the sage . ”
“Why?”
“If you walk this staircase while thinking about your worries, your worries are solved . ”
*
It was literally like so .
People who have started climbing the stairs with their own problems stopped step by step .
Then they turned around and started going down the stairs .
There was no magic staircase that solved people’s concerns .
“Heuk, heuk… . keuhk . ”
The priestess was breathing heavily .
It was a natural reaction .
As such, this staircase was a structure that was difficult for ordinary people to climb .
It was so steep that you can’t stop to rest .
The slope gets worse, and it becomes almost the level of rock climbing .
If you miss your step, you would fall right away .
It was a staircase that instilled not only physical suffering but also mental horror .
As you climb stairs like this, minor worries will naturally disappear from your mind .
It was natural .
Even the worries that were not there will disappear .
